Durability and everyday wear are central to the design philosophy of wearable heirlooms, and aquamarine is especially well suited for jewelry that is intended to be worn frequently, not merely admired. As a member of the beryl family, this stone combines a Mohs hardness in the range of 7.5 to 8, with a robustness that resists scratches from common materials, and the asscher cut with its stepped pavilion distributes impact across broader facets, reducing the risk of chipping along vulnerable edges. Thoughtful mounting will enhance longevity, so settings that protect the girdle and corners, such as a bezel or a four prong design with reinforced corner prongs, are ideal for daily rings, pendants, and bracelets. Routine care is simple and forgiving, warm soapy water and a soft brush restore brilliance, and modest precautions against hard knocks and harsh chemicals preserve the surface polish, allowing this gem to hold its color and luster for generations.
